DVS1 & WORK present: Wall of Sound Los Angeles (Mini Documentary)

dvs1 wall-of-sound 30 Jan 2026

Wall of Sound is not a party concept. It is a dance floor experiment experiment in listening.This documentary revisits Wall of Sound Los Angeles — January 2025, featuring DVS1 and Traxx, released one year after the night itself. Rather than documenting a moment for immediacy, this film reflects on why the night was built the way it was—and what it asks of both artist and audience.Through conversations with DVS1, sound engineer Andy Fitton, lighting director Strobert and WORK curator Marco Sgalbazzini, the film explores the often-unseen architecture behind the experience: sound as intention, lighting as restraint, and curation as responsibility.

Wall of Sound prioritizes clarity over volume, presence over spectacle, and trust over trend. Every decision, from system tuning to lighting design to lineup curation, is made in service of one goal: creating the conditions for music to be fully experienced.
